Gearbox is ready to drop out why wont it separate from the engine looks like thrust bearing is connected to pressure plate how does it come off.

This should be a conventional push type clutch, the bearing may have collapsed or a pressure plate finger may have collapsed and jagged the thrust bearing, it should separate with out any problem,
